SED 명령은 "[Word1 Word2]"를 공백으로 바꿉니다.

SED 명령은 "[Word1 Word2]"를 공백으로 바꿉니다.

"[word1 word2]"와 같은 텍스트를 아무것도 바꾸지 않는 sed 명령을 찾고 있습니다.

나는 노력했다

sed -i -e 's/[Word1 Word2]//g'

그것은 작동하지 않았고 전체 텍스트를 순서 없는 방식으로 대체했습니다.

이러한 특수 문자를 대체할 수 있도록 도움을 요청하고 싶습니다.

고마워요, 퍼니스.

답변1

대괄호 []특수 문자입니다 sed. 다음과 같이 백슬래시를 사용하여 이스케이프 처리해야 합니다.

sed -i -e 's/\[Word1 Word2\]//g'

관련 정보